Transcribed Image Text:For the matrix \( A \), find (if possible) a nonsingular matrix \( P \) such that \( P^{-1}AP \) is diagonal. (If not possible, enter IMPOSSIBLE.)
\[
A = \begin{bmatrix}
2 & 0 & 0 \\
2 & -2 & -1 \\
-1 & 0 & -2
\end{bmatrix}
\]
\[
P = \begin{bmatrix}
\Box & \Box & \Box \\
\Box & \Box & \Box \\
\Box & \Box & \Box
\end{bmatrix}
\]
Verify that \( P^{-1}AP \) is a diagonal matrix with the eigenvalues on the main diagonal.
\[
P^{-1}AP = \begin{bmatrix}
\Box & \Box & \Box \\
\Box & \Box & \Box \\
\Box & \Box & \Box
\end{bmatrix}
\]
